Navicat速连MySQL8.0.21数据库指南
navicat连接mysql8.0.21

首页 2025-06-20 14:07:03



Navicat连接MySQL8.0.21:高效管理与优化数据库的必备工具 在当今信息化高速发展的时代,数据库作为数据存储与管理的核心组件,其重要性不言而喻

    MySQL,作为开源数据库管理系统中的佼佼者,凭借其高性能、可靠性和易用性,在Web应用、数据分析、云计算等多个领域占据了举足轻重的地位

    而MySQL8.0.21版本,更是带来了众多性能提升和新特性,使得数据库管理变得更加高效与安全

    然而,要充分发挥MySQL8.0.21的潜力,一个强大的数据库管理工具不可或缺

    Navicat,作为一款专为数据库管理员和开发人员设计的通用数据库管理工具,正是连接并高效管理MySQL8.0.21的理想选择

     一、Navicat简介:数据库管理的瑞士军刀 Navicat自问世以来,便以其直观的用户界面、丰富的功能集以及跨平台兼容性赢得了广泛赞誉

    无论是数据库设计、数据传输、数据同步,还是数据备份与恢复,Navicat都能提供一站式解决方案

    它支持多种数据库类型,包括但不限于MySQL、MariaDB、MongoDB、SQLite、Oracle、PostgreSQL等,这意味着用户可以在同一个界面中管理多种数据库,极大地提高了工作效率

     二、为何选择Navicat连接MySQL8.0.21 2.1直观易用的界面设计 Navicat的界面设计简洁明了,采用直观的图形化操作方式,即便是数据库管理新手也能迅速上手

    通过简单的拖拽操作,用户可以轻松创建表、视图、索引等数据库对象,大大简化了数据库设计流程

    同时,Navicat提供了丰富的上下文菜单和快捷键支持,使得日常的数据库管理工作更加高效

     2.2强大的数据导入导出功能 在数据迁移或数据交换场景中,Navicat的数据导入导出功能显得尤为重要

    它支持多种数据格式(如CSV、Excel、JSON等)的导入导出,并且能够在导入过程中进行数据清洗和转换,确保数据的准确性和一致性

    此外,Navicat还支持通过ODBC/JDBC连接其他数据源,实现跨平台、跨系统的数据交互,为数据整合提供了极大的便利

     2.3 智能的数据同步与备份 数据同步与备份是数据库管理中不可或缺的两个环节

    Navicat提供了灵活的数据同步方案,允许用户设定定时任务,自动将源数据库的变化同步到目标数据库,确保数据的一致性

    同时,Navicat的数据备份功能支持全量备份和增量备份,用户可以根据实际需求选择合适的备份策略,有效防止数据丢失

    更重要的是,Navicat的备份文件可以加密存储,进一步提升了数据的安全性

     2.4高效的查询与调试工具 对于开发人员而言,高效的查询编写与调试能力是衡量数据库管理工具好坏的重要标准之一

    Navicat内置了强大的SQL编辑器,支持语法高亮、自动补全、代码折叠等功能,极大地提升了SQL编写效率

    此外,Navicat还提供了执行计划分析、性能监控等高级功能,帮助开发人员优化SQL语句,提升数据库性能

     2.5 与MySQL8.0.21的完美兼容 MySQL8.0.21引入了许多新特性,如更强大的加密功能、优化的JSON处理、窗口函数支持等,这些都对数据库管理工具提出了更高的兼容性要求

    Navicat凭借其对MySQL版本的持续跟进和优化,确保了与MySQL8.0.21的完美兼容

    无论是新特性的利用,还是旧功能的维护,Navicat都能为用户提供无缝的体验

     三、Navicat连接MySQL8.0.21实战指南 3.1 安装与配置 首先,确保已安装Navicat和MySQL8.0.21,并启动MySQL服务

    打开Navicat,点击左上角的“连接”按钮,选择“MySQL”作为连接类型

    在弹出的连接窗口中,输入MySQL服务器的地址、端口号(默认为3306)、用户名和密码,点击“测试连接”确认信息无误后,保存连接配置

     3.2 数据库管理 连接成功后,即可在Navicat的左侧面板中看到新建立的MySQL连接

    展开连接节点,可以看到数据库列表、表列表等

    用户可以通过右键菜单进行数据库的创建、删除、重命名等操作,也可以直接双击表名进入表设计视图,进行字段添加、修改、删除等细致操作

     3.3 数据导入导出 选择需要导入或导出的数据库或表,右键点击选择“导入向导”或“导出向导”,按照提示选择文件格式、设置字段映射等,即可完成数据的导入导出

    特别地,对于大规模数据导入,Navicat支持批量处理和事务控制,确保数据导入的高效与安全

     3.4 SQL查询与调试 在Navicat中打开SQL编辑器,输入SQL语句并执行

    编辑器会根据语法自动高亮显示,并提供智能提示

    对于复杂的查询,可以利用执行计划分析功能,查看查询的执行路径和成本,从而进行针对性的优化

    此外,Navicat还支持调试存储过程和触发器,通过断点设置、单步执行等方式,帮助开发人员定位并解决问题

     3.5 数据同步与备份 利用Navicat的数据同步功能,可以轻松实现两个数据库之间的数据同步

    设置同步任务时,可以选择同步方向、同步策略(如全量同步、增量同步)等

    对于数据备份,可以设定定时任务,自动执行备份操作,并将备份文件保存到指定位置

    同时,不要忘记为备份文件设置密码,增强数据的安全性

     四、结语 综上所述,Navicat凭借其直观易用的界面设计、强大的数据导入导出功能、智能的数据同步与备份机制、高效的查询与调试工具,以及与MySQL8.0.21的完美兼容性,成为了连接并高效管理MySQL数据库的不二之选

    无论是数据库管理员还是开发人员,都能通过Navicat显著提升工作效率,确保数据的安全与准确

    在未来的数据库管理之路上,Navicat将继续发挥其独特优势,助力用户轻松应对各种挑战,共创数据价值的新篇章

    

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道